Work will involve adding 60 new retail and dining outlets
Dubai-based Majid Al-Futtaim (MAF) has released details of a RO27m ($70m) second phase to the expansion to City Centre Muscat.
The project, which will start later this year, will add 60 new shopping and dining outlets to the mall with a total area of 10,000 square metres. Phase 2 of City Centre Muscats redevelopment is expected to be complete in 2015.
The RO8.3m first phase of the City Centre Muscat expansion was recently completed. It involved building 10-screen VOX Cinemas plus enhancements made to Magic Planet and the food court dining area. The local Douglas OHI was the contractor.
A new car park structure, currently under construction will accommodate 700 vehicles to provide more convenience to shoppers.
Muscat City Centre was MAFs first shopping and leisure complex outside the UAE and features more than 150 local and international retail brands. In 2007, the mall underwent a RO22.5m expansion, which doubled the malls retail space
